Other symptoms of MS include a variety of physical problems. For example, people with MS often have difficulty speaking and swallowing, and their speech may become slurred. They may also lose sensation in certain areas of the body, including their legs and arms. In addition, these symptoms may cause a tingling or numbness. Fortunately, MS is not fatal and treatment options can vary greatly. Symptoms of Multiple Sclerosis may range from mild to severe.

Depending on the type of MS, symptoms may be mild, intermittent, or nonexistent at first. The severity of each symptom depends on where in the central nervous system the disease is affecting and how badly it has affected the patient’s function. Individuals with MS may experience multiple symptoms, and these symptoms may come and go over time. There is no cure for Multiple Sclerosis, but there are treatments that can slow down the disease’s progression and improve function and quality of life.

Fatigue is a common symptom of MS, which can interfere with daily activities. People with MS may experience fatigue after exercise, and this fatigue may persist throughout the day. Some people may even feel tired even after a full night’s sleep. People with MS also tend to suffer from abnormal sensations throughout the body, including the legs, arms, and neck. In some cases, these symptoms may spread over several days and can be severe.

MS symptoms can also include social, psychological, and work-related difficulties. Oftentimes, people with MS are not as social as they were before they began to develop the disease, and they can become depressed. While the disease can be disabling, many people learn how to manage their symptoms and lead a normal, active life. However, the severity of the symptoms is often unpredictable. MS occurs in anyone. Often, the onset of the disease occurs between ages 20 and 40. But it can also affect younger people. Women are more likely to develop relapsing-remitting MS than men. People with a family history of MS are at increased risk. Research also suggests that certain viruses, such as the Epstein-Barr virus, may increase the risk of developing MS.
